Came in a huge box via UPS today. Careful: It weighs 90 pounds. I guess guilt is heavy. Even though I live about 2 miles from the Corner, the box was shipped from Indiana. I could have saved them a lot of trouble. I got a pair of blue seats (was hoping for orange since I usually sat in those as a kid). There is some paint wear in spots. The armrest between them is rather rusty. They still pull down with that same "creeeeeeeak" that I remember from my childhood, though. Oddly, they are a lot smaller width-wise than I remember. They also are a lot dirtier than I remember. Makes me wish they came complete with a friendly, elderly usher to clean 'em up. Would have been nice if Schneider or whomever could have hosed them down for you first. I went through half a roll of paper towel on one seat alone. Not exaggerating. I feel bad having them here in Southwest Detroit when they belong at Michigan and Trumbull, but when she's gone, I'll be glad I saved at least a little piece. I'd rather have these than a 1997 Opening Day on-deck circle thing or whatever other crap they were selling. Anyone get any of the Tiger Den chairs? If these are this dirty, I can't imagine how bad those must have been to clean. |

According to the Freep, they sold just under 7000 pairs of seats. I can't imagine many would come from the upper deck since there's no easy way to get them down on the ground. 14,000 seats out of 40,000+ means a lot will probably just be cut up...how sad! |
